Job Summary
Provides administrative assistance and logistical support to the Histology Laboratory through a general understanding of Surgical Pathology Laboratory Operations and regulatory requirements.
Responsibilities
- Prepares cases to be grossed-in in the Histology laboratory, accessions cases, checks tissue-examination forms and specimens for completeness and accuracy, and labels specimen cassettes and slides with accession numbers according to varied specimen requirements.
- Assists in processing specimens for testing at the Regional Laboratory Histology Department.
- Follows established procedures for processing patient samples and determines the acceptability of specimens.
- Places orders for tests to be performed at reference laboratories and communicates with medical, clinical, and technical staff regarding specimen inquiries and problems.
- Maintains departmental reports, tissue blocks, and slides in proper order and storage.
- Files and maintains microscope slides and paraffin blocks.
- Performs instrument and equipment maintenance, troubleshooting, and records actions taken.
- Prepares stains, performs, and documents QC on stains and reagents in accordance with regulatory standards.
- Assists pathologists in fine needle aspiration procedures, maintaining related reagents and stains.
- Adheres to laboratory safety and infection control practices, wearing protective equipment as required.
- Recycles chemicals and disposes of biohazardous waste per policies.
- Maintains inventory of supplies, orders supplies, and keeps work area clean and organized.
- Maintains patient confidentiality and presents a professional manner to patients and staff.
- Shuttles specimens and documents between the laboratory and pathology offices.
- Assists with training new employees and performs other duties as assigned.
